技术文摘
多列布局在现代CSS布局中是否仍有价值
2025-01-09 17:59:13 小编
多列布局在现代CSS布局中是否仍有价值
在现代CSS布局的大舞台上,各种新的布局方式如Flexbox和Grid布局等崭露头角,备受青睐。那么,传统的多列布局是否还有其存在的价值呢?
多列布局曾经是网页设计中创建多列文本内容的常用方法。它能将文本内容自动分成多列,使页面在有限的空间内展示更多信息,提升内容的可读性和整体美观度。例如,在一些新闻网站或杂志风格的网页中,多列布局可以让长篇文章呈现得更加清晰,方便用户阅读。
然而,随着Flexbox和Grid布局的出现,它们提供了更为强大和灵活的布局能力。Flexbox主要用于一维布局,能够轻松实现元素的对齐、排序和分配空间。Grid布局则是二维布局系统,对页面的行和列进行精确控制,能创建复杂的网格结构。相比之下,多列布局的功能似乎显得有些局限。
但这并不意味着多列布局就毫无价值。在某些特定场景下,多列布局依然有着不可替代的优势。比如,当我们只需要简单快速地将一段文本分成多列展示时,多列布局的代码简洁性就体现出来了。它不需要像Grid布局那样进行复杂的行列设置,只需几行简单的CSS代码就能实现多列效果。
而且,多列布局对于一些老旧浏览器的兼容性较好。在一些对浏览器兼容性要求较高的项目中,多列布局可以作为一种保底的布局方式,确保页面在各种浏览器上都能有相对稳定的展示效果。
多列布局在一些简单的文档类网页或移动端一些对性能要求较高的页面中,由于其轻量级的特性,也能发挥出独特的作用。
虽然现代CSS布局中有了更强大的Flexbox和Grid布局,但多列布局在特定场景下仍有其价值。它与其他布局方式并非相互排斥,而是可以相互补充,共同为我们打造出更优秀的网页布局。
- CSS用!important解决IE6 IE7 Firefox兼容性问题
- JavaScript调试工具MultipleIE助力多版本浏览器共存
- IE8与IE7共存的两种方法大揭秘
- 同一样式表中区分IE6、IE7和Firefox样式的方法
- CSSHACK写法实现对IE6、IE7、IE8及Firefox浏览器的全面兼容
- 微软:IE9将成全球最快最安全浏览器
- IE和Firefox浏览器的差异及常见问题汇总
- 微软展示IE9浏览器 力推IE8取代IE6市场
- IE系列市场份额数据:IE7垫底,IE8有望赶超IE6
- IE6、IE7、IE8浏览器兼容性较量
- 提升程序运行速度 使Ext JS兼具华丽与实用
- Java创始人称Android是为竞争而非为钱而开发
- IE6、IE7、IE8及Firefox兼容的几种解决方法
- IE6、IE7、Firefox兼容的两种实现方案
- IE6不支持的十个实用CSS属性